Cinnamon Apple Oatmeal Bars

Cinnamon Apple Oatmeal Bars That Are Guilt-Free Goodness

Cinnamon Apple Oatmeal Bars are a delicious, healthy treat with just three ingredients, perfect for breakfast or a snack.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Cooling Time 30 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
Servings: 12 bars
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

For the Base
  • 1 cup Sweetened Cinnamon Applesauce Can substitute with unsweetened applesauce and add 2 teaspoons of cinnamon.
  • 1/2 cup Natural Peanut Butter or Almond Butter Can swap for sunflower seed butter for a nut-free option.
  • 2 cups Quick Oats Regular rolled oats can be pulsed in a food processor to improve binding.

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(177°C) and line an 8x8 inch baking pan with parchment paper.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the sweetened cinnamon applesauce and natural peanut or almond butter until smooth and uniform.
  3. Gently fold in the quick oats until all oats are evenly coated and incorporated.
  4. Pour the oatmeal mixture into the prepared baking pan and spread it out evenly, pressing down firmly.
  5. Bake for 15-20 minutes until the surface is dry and lightly golden.
  6. Let the bars cool completely in the pan on a wire rack, then lift them out and cut into squares or rectangles.
  7.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week or freeze for longer storage.

Notes

These bars are versatile; feel free to customize with your favorite mix-ins like chocolate chips or dried fruits. Always taste the mixture before baking to adjust sweetness or spices to your liking.
